Verdict

RYEDALE RACER gets a chance to make amends after failing to land the odds over track and trip last time. Malcolm Jefferson's charge had gone close at Hexham earlier and a repeat effort would be good enough in this. Silver Shuffle is usually thereabouts but has yet to win over hurdles in 34 attempts and had an alternative engagement this weekend so the lightly-raced Rolling Thunder makes more appeal on his recent third at Musselburgh. Rock On Bollinski has won a couple of low grade handicaps on the Flat but makes his hurdling debut today.
